In this episode of the Talking Pools podcast, Peter, Shane, and Lee reflecting on personal health challenges, and career transitions. They explore the emotional aspects of leaving a long-standing career, the impact of mentorship on personal and professional growth, and the importance of prioritizing family and well-being. The conversation concludes with gratitude for the experiences shared and the relationships built within the industry.

takeaways

  • The Mentor of the Year Award recognizes impactful contributions in the pool industry.
  • Mentorship is crucial for shaping careers and fostering growth.
  • Health challenges can influence career decisions and priorities.
  • It's important to prioritize family and personal well-being over work.
  • Leaving a long-term career can be a significant emotional transition.
  • Recognition in the industry should be earned through contributions, not just reputation.
  • The importance of community and support in professional environments.
  • Career transitions can lead to new opportunities for personal growth.
  • Reflecting on past experiences can provide clarity for future decisions.
  • Gratitude for shared experiences enhances professional relationships.
